The entrance exam of M.Des programme in NIFT consists of GAT, CAT followed by a group discussion and an interview. There is no studio test for M.Des.

No, unfortunately Symbiosis School of Design does not offer automobile design course. You can consider the following colleges for pursuing automobile/transportation design:
1. Industrial Design Centre, IIT Bombay
2. National Institute of Design, Ahmedabad
3. Department of Design, IIT Guwahati
4. Indian Institute of Technology, Delhi
5. Indian Institute of Technology, Kanpur.

Yes,
You are free to choose the campus you want with the available options with your rank. Counselling session happens rank wise. And as the rank goes lower and lower, seats get filled up and when your turn comes up, at that point, whichever campus are left as option, you'll have to choose out of them. So basically the better the rank, the more the options.
